Puertos de red: qué son, tipos y para qué sirven

Última actualización:
Autor:

protocolos de red más comunes-4 Seguro que alguna vez has escuchado que para jugar online o hacer funcionar alguna aplicación concreta, necesitabas abrir un puerto en tu router. Pero, ¿qué significa eso exactamente? ¿Qué es un puerto de red y para qué sirve? Aunque suele parecer un concepto complicado reservado para expertos en informática, en realidad es algo que afecta a todos los que usamos Internet a diario.

Los puertos son fundamentales en el funcionamiento de cualquier comunicación por red. Están presentes cuando ves una serie por streaming, haces una videollamada, juegas con tus amigos o simplemente navegas por una web. Son como las puertas virtuales que hacen posible que varias aplicaciones compartan la misma conexión sin estorbarse entre sí. En este artículo, vamos a ver en profundidad qué son, los distintos tipos que existen, cómo se clasifican, por qué son importantes y cuáles son los puertos más usados tanto en redes domésticas como corporativas.

¿Qué es un puerto de red y para qué se utiliza?

Un puerto de red es un identificador numérico lógico que se asigna a procesos o aplicaciones específicas dentro de un dispositivo conectado a una red. A pesar de que se les llama «puertos», no son físicos como las entradas USB, sino que funcionan de forma virtual dentro del sistema operativo y el software de red.

Gracias a los puertos, los dispositivos pueden saber a qué servicio o aplicación debe ir la información que llega. Por ejemplo, cuando accedes a una página web mediante tu navegador, esa solicitud es enviada al puerto 80 si la web no encripta los datos, o al puerto 443 si lo hace mediante HTTPS. El servidor al otro lado sabe entonces cómo interpretar la petición y qué aplicación debe procesarla.

Cada puerto está asociado a una aplicación concreta: el correo electrónico, la navegación web, las descargas, los videojuegos online, el acceso remoto, etc. Así se permite que diversos servicios funcionen a la vez en un mismo dispositivo sin interferencias. En otras palabras, el puerto de red actúa como un canal de comunicación entre el sistema operativo y los servicios externos o internos.

Números de puerto disponibles y su gestión

Se utilizan números que van del 0 al 65535, ya que están representados en una palabra de 16 bits. Esto significa que hay más de 65.000 puertos virtuales disponibles en cada dispositivo.

La asignación de estos puertos no es aleatoria ni automática. Existe un organismo internacional llamado IANA (Internet Assigned Numbers Authority), que se encarga de controlar y mantener una base de datos de asignaciones de puerto para evitar conflictos entre protocolos y aplicaciones.

Esta numeración está dividida en tres rangos principales:

  • Puertos bien conocidos (0 al 1023): son los que están reservados para servicios de red estándar y esenciales como HTTP, FTP, DNS, SSH, SMTP y otros. Necesitan privilegios administrativos para ser utilizados por aplicaciones.
  • Puertos registrados (1024 al 49151): son asignados a aplicaciones o servicios específicos por la IANA, pero pueden ser utilizados libremente por software que lo solicite. Por ejemplo, MySQL utiliza el 3306, Discord el 6463, etc.
  • Puertos dinámicos o privados (49152 al 65535): son asignados temporalmente de forma automática por el sistema operativo a las conexiones salientes. A estos también se les llama puertos efímeros.
  Cómo transferir archivos entre servicios de almacenamiento con Air Explorer

Tipos de puertos de red

Protocolo TCP vs. UDP: diferencias clave

Los puertos son utilizados por los protocolos de la capa de transporte del modelo OSI, principalmente por TCP (Transmission Control Protocol) y UDP (User Datagram Protocol). Ambos usan los mismos números de puerto, pero con diferencias clave en su comportamiento:

  • TCP: orientado a la conexión, confiable y garantiza que los datos lleguen en orden y sin errores. Es usado por servicios como el correo (SMTP, POP3, IMAP), navegación web (HTTP/HTTPS), FTP, SSH o bases de datos como MySQL. Requiere más ancho de banda y procesamiento, pero es más seguro.
  • UDP: no orientado a conexión, no garantiza entrega ni orden. Es más rápido y simple, usado para servicios que requieren baja latencia como videollamadas, juegos online, DNS, SNMP o streaming. Tiene menos control, pero consume menos recursos.

Una misma aplicación puede utilizar ambos dependiendo de su configuración o necesidad. Por ejemplo, OpenVPN puede funcionar tanto en TCP como en UDP mediante el puerto 1194.

Ejemplos de puertos TCP más utilizados

En redes domésticas y empresariales, muchos puertos TCP son ampliamente utilizados en la comunicación con distintos servicios. Aquí te listamos algunos de los más conocidos y sus usos principales:

  • 21: FTP en modo control — transferencia de archivos.
  • 22: SSH — acceso remoto y conexiones cifradas.
  • 23: Telnet — acceso remoto sin cifrado (inseguro).
  • 25 / 587: SMTP — envío de correos, estándar y cifrado.
  • 53: DNS — resolución de nombres (puede usar TCP o UDP).
  • 80: HTTP — navegación web sin cifrado.
  • 443: HTTPS — navegación web cifrada.
  • 3306: MySQL — base de datos.
  • 3389: Escritorio remoto de Windows.
  • 25565: Minecraft — servidor de juego online.

Cada protocolo o software tiene puertos asignados, y cualquier conflicto entre ellos puede generar errores de conexión o pérdida de funcionalidad.

Puertos UDP comunes y sus aplicaciones

UDP, al ser más rápido, es esencial para ciertas aplicaciones en tiempo real o donde la pérdida de unos pocos paquetes no compromete la funcionalidad. Algunos ejemplos:

  • 53: DNS — resolución de dominios.
  • 67 y 68: DHCP — asignación automática de IPs.
  • 69: TFTP — transferencia de archivos ligera.
  • 123: NTP — sincronización de relojes.
  • 500: IPsec (VPN) con ISAKMP.
  • 3478 a 3481: Skype y otros para videollamadas.
  • 1194: OpenVPN — protocolo seguro y eficiente para VPN.
  Cómo Arreglar Firefox No Pudo Cargar XPCOM

UDP es menos confiable, pero mucho más ligero, por lo que es el preferido en juegos, videollamadas y servicios de streaming. Muchas veces, si hay cortes, se debe a que el puerto UDP correspondiente está bloqueado o mal configurado en el firewall o router.

Importancia de abrir puertos correctamente

En muchas ocasiones es necesario abrir puertos manualmente en el router para permitir el ingreso de tráfico desde fuera de tu red. Esto se conoce como port forwarding o reenvío de puertos. Es esencial en entornos con NAT (como redes domésticas) donde todos los dispositivos comparten una sola IP pública.

Algunas situaciones comunes donde es útil configurar los puertos manualmente son:

  • Jugar online: cada juego usa puertos distintos y abrirlos mejora el rendimiento y reduce el ping.
  • Videollamadas: programas como Skype, Meet, Zoom o Discord requieren ciertos puertos para funcionar con fluidez.
  • Servidores domésticos: ya sea un NAS, FTP o web, si quieres acceder desde fuera, necesitarás configurar los puertos.
  • Conexiones P2P: como BitTorrent, eMule y similares, que se conectan con otros usuarios.

No abrirlos correctamente puede generar problemas como:

  • Cortes en videollamadas
  • Baja velocidad de descarga
  • Conexiones fallidas en videojuegos

Por eso, es vital realizar una configuración correcta y abrir solo los puertos necesarios para cada aplicación o dispositivo.

Puertos y seguridad en la red: ¿cuáles son peligrosos?

Los puertos abiertos no supervisados pueden ser una puerta de entrada para ciberataques. Algunos puertos son más vulnerables debido a los servicios que suelen estar corriendo detrás de ellos. Por ejemplo, el puerto 23 de Telnet es inseguro por naturaleza porque transmite los datos sin cifrado.

Otros puertos comúnmente explotados por malware, troyanos o herramientas automatizadas de hacking incluyen:

  • 21: FTP — si no utiliza cifrado, puede ser interceptado.
  • 23: Telnet — inseguro y vulnerable.
  • 80: HTTP — aún muy usado sin cifrado.
  • 3389: Escritorio remoto de Windows — blanco habitual de ataques RDP.
  • 22: SSH — si se utilizan credenciales débiles.
  • 445: SMB — usado por virus como WannaCry para propagarse.

También hay puertos utilizados específicamente por troyanos y herramientas de intrusión, como 12345 (NetBus), 31337 (Back Orifice) o 4444 (generalmente malware).

Por eso, es recomendable:

  • Usar firewalls para bloquear todos los puertos innecesarios.
  • Limitar el acceso solo a direcciones IP concretas si se expone un puerto.
  • Mantener actualizado el software que escuche en esos puertos.
  • Utilizar IDS/IPS para detectar tráfico anómalo.
  Matter 1.4: La nueva actualización que transforma el hogar inteligente

Y cerrar siempre los puertos que no necesites usar.

Cómo saber qué puertos tienes abiertos: herramientas útiles

Comprobar qué puertos están abiertos en tu red o equipo es fundamental para controlar posibles puntos de entrada. Estas son algunas formas de hacerlo:

  • Desde internet: puedes usar páginas como ShieldsUP! de GRC o herramientas como nmap desde el exterior para ver qué puertos tienes expuestos.
  • Desde tu propia red: si estás dentro de la red, puedes usar herramientas como netstat o nmap para ver qué puertos están abiertos localmente.

Ejemplo de uso básico:

nmap -sU -sT 192.168.1.1

Esto escanea tanto TCP como UDP para el equipo con dirección IP 192.168.1.1. También puedes especificar un puerto concreto o un rango.

Si descubres que tienes puertos abiertos que no usas, lo ideal es cerrarlos desde la configuración del router o del firewall interno del sistema operativo.

El problema de la CG-NAT

Un factor importante que impide abrir puertos es estar bajo CG-NAT (Carrier Grade NAT). Muchas operadoras lo usan para ahorrar direcciones IPv4 públicas, compartiéndola entre distintos usuarios.

Cuando estás en CG-NAT, no puedes abrir puertos manualmente porque no tienes control sobre la IP pública que gestiona tu tráfico. Como consecuencia, servicios como servidores de juego, FTP o acceso remoto dejarán de estar disponibles desde el exterior.

Algunas opciones para salir de CG-NAT:

  • Llamar a tu operador y pedir una dirección IP pública (puede tener coste adicional).
  • Solicitar activación de IPv6 si lo soportan.
  • Usar una VPN que permita conexiones entrantes.

Entender qué es un puerto de red, cómo funciona, qué tipos existen y cómo configurarlos correctamente puede marcar una gran diferencia en el rendimiento y seguridad de tu conexión. Desde mejorar tu experiencia en juegos y llamadas hasta protegerte frente a ataques cibernéticos, su correcta administración es básica tanto en redes personales como corporativas. Aunque muchas veces pase desapercibido, este componente invisible de la red es el que permite que todo fluya correctamente cada vez que abres tu navegador, haces clic en un enlace o descargas un archivo.

Tipos de Firewalls
Artículo relacionado:
Tipos de Firewalls: Protege tu Red con las Mejores Soluciones de Seguridad

Deja un comentario